You will work closely within a small, dynamic team acting as initial contact for all internal and external Driver and Vehicle Licensing Agency (DVLA) room bookings enquiries, providing information on the facility and services available.
We will look to you to monitor mailboxes, promptly responding to queries whilst also working collaboratively with team colleagues and stakeholders to ensure quality, timescales and standards are met.
You will also support reception duties in our Swansea Vale contact centre, providing an effective and efficient first point of contact with all visitors, and undertaking administrative duties.
Customer service skills are essential for this role as you will be representing the agency when dealing with internal and external stakeholders. You will be confident in providing excellent customer service and love to go the extra mile to ensure you give a first-class service.
This role will require you to work on-site at our Swansea Vale offices, Richard Ley Development Centre (RLDC) and Contact Centre.

About Disability Confident
A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
